ExxonMobil Corp, a global energy giant, has recently wrapped up its annual maintenance work at the Joliet refinery in Illinois, signaling a significant milestone in its operational agenda. According to industry sources speaking on Tuesday, the company is currently in the process of restarting operations at the facility, marking a crucial step towards ensuring smooth refinery operations in the coming months.

The sources, who requested anonymity to discuss confidential information, shed light on the completion of maintenance activities at the 250,000-barrel-per-day Joliet refinery. This facility, a cornerstone of ExxonMobil’s refining operations, primarily processes Canadian crude oil, playing a pivotal role in meeting the energy demands of the region. With an estimated daily production capacity of around 9 million gallons of gasoline and diesel, the Joliet refinery serves as a vital hub in ExxonMobil’s downstream operations, catering to the needs of consumers and industries alike.

Separately, in a move highlighting its commitment to environmental sustainability and innovative energy solutions, ExxonMobil has entered into a significant partnership in Indonesia. Indonesia’s state energy firm Pertamina, alongside ExxonMobil and South Korea’s KNOC, have signed a framework agreement for the development of a carbon capture and storage (CCS) hub in Indonesia. This collaborative initiative underscores the companies’ collective efforts to mitigate carbon emissions and address climate change concerns by deploying advanced CCS technologies.

The envisioned CCS hub development holds immense potential for Indonesia, a country grappling with the dual challenges of industrial growth and environmental conservation. By leveraging ExxonMobil’s expertise in carbon capture technologies, coupled with Pertamina’s regional presence and KNOC’s strategic insights, the partnership aims to establish a robust framework for capturing and storing carbon emissions generated by industrial activities.

XOM Stock Forecast & Analysis

The analysis of Exxon Mobil Corp’s stock performance provides investors with valuable insights into the company’s potential trajectory, blending expert opinions and statistical indicators.

According to the forecast from 14 analysts, the average target price for Exxon Mobil Corp’s stock is projected to reach USD 129.76 within the next 12 months. This indicates an optimistic outlook among analysts, with a consensus rating of “Buy” on average. Such sentiment reflects positive expectations regarding Exxon Mobil’s future performance, likely buoyed by factors such as its diversified operations, global presence, and ongoing efforts to adapt to evolving market dynamics.

Stock Target Advisor’s own analysis presents a more cautious perspective, characterizing Exxon Mobil Corp’s stock as “Slightly Bearish.” This assessment is based on a comprehensive evaluation of various signals, including both positive and negative indicators. While there are 4 positive signals suggesting potential upside, they are outweighed by 8 negative signals, highlighting areas of concern or potential risks. This slightly bearish stance suggests a more conservative approach, acknowledging potential challenges Exxon Mobil may face in the near term.

At the last closing, Exxon Mobil Corp’s stock price stood at USD 117.67, reflecting a mixed performance over recent periods. The stock registered a modest increase of +1.29% over the past week, indicating some positive momentum. However, it experienced a slight decline of -2.24% over the past month, possibly influenced by broader market dynamics and sector-specific factors. Nevertheless, over the last year, the stock has demonstrated resilience, posting a noteworthy gain of +11.24%, showcasing Exxon Mobil’s ability to navigate through market fluctuations.
